I can't blame you. I consider myself a CD collector and for quite some time I would ridicule those who spun a disc more than once (during the ripping). My intent was to get into SACD since it became clear to me that there were more of interest (for both unique mastering and content) than I'd originally thought. I'm not one to spite myself. Well, at least not for too long! I'd planned to stream redbook and hi-res PCM and spin SACDs. Then it became inconveniently clear that spinning a redbook disc sounded better than when played through the DAC section (via S/PDIF from Transporter). I hadn't considered there could be a difference and I sure didn't want to hear it. So then I looked into how that could happen and, of course, it came to light that the DAC input section of players do not have the same path as it does from the integrated transport. Well, I wasn't going to give up even the slightest resolution. I broke away from streaming. I'll be back in it before long.
